Një skedar binar është një dokument teksti i koduar me një shtrirje *. BIN. Ky lloj skedari përdoret në programet e aplikimit dhe përmban informacion në lidhje me softuerin. Mund të ruani çdo lloj të dhëne: vargjet, numrat e plotë ose booleans - dhe të kodifikoni informacionin.
E nevojshme
- - Shkathtësi programimi;
- - kompjuter.
Udhëzimet
Hapi 1
Jepni kodit të faqes së projektit tuaj një emër të përshtatshëm. Shkrimi dhe leximi i skedarëve kërkon emra "IO", siç quhen bibliotekat e klasave të përdorura nga zhvilluesi. Shkrimi i skedarëve kërkon klasa të përfshira në ndryshoret I / O. Shtoni rreshtin vijues në fillim të kodit të skedarit: "përfshini System. IO;".
Hapi 2
Krijoni një rrjedhë skedari dhe caktoni një vlerë binare në ndryshore. Kjo do të krijojë një skedar binar, por tani do të jetë bosh. Binaret mund të krijohen me çdo zgjatim, por *. BIN është standardi. Përdorni kodin e mëposhtëm për të krijuar një skedar binar: "Skedari FileStream = FileStream i ri (" C: / mybinaryfile.bin ", FileMode. Create); BinaryWriter binarystream = i ri BinaryWriter (skedar); ".
Hapi 3
Shtoni një funksion shkrimi në skedarin binar duke përdorur komandën "Shkruaj". Ky funksion kodifikon automatikisht vlerat në modalitetin binar, kështu që nuk keni më nevojë ta kodifikoni informacionin përpara se ta ruani në një skedar. Më poshtë është një shembull i shkrimit në një skedar binar: "binarystream. Write (" Skedari im i parë binar ");
binarystream. Write (10);"
Hapi 4
Mbyllni skedarin sa më shpejt që të jenë ruajtur të gjitha informacionet e nevojshme. Mbyllja e një skedari është e rëndësishme në programim sepse përfundon procesin e krijimit të skedarit dhe e hap atë për përdorim nga përdoruesit ose aplikacione të tjera. Linja tjetër mbyll binarin dhe e ruan atë në diskun e ngurtë: "binarystream. Close ();".
Hapi 5
Testoni skedarin binar. Drejtoni aplikacionin, informacionin për të cilin keni vendosur në dokumentin e krijuar. Nëse gjithçka funksionon në mënyrë të patëmetë, atëherë kodi i përpiluar është i saktë. Përndryshe, përdorni funksionin e korrigjimit të skedarit binar, vini re nëse komandat e kodit janë shkruar si duhet.